29 /* Despite the rest of the comments in this file, (FIXME-SOON),
30 here is the current scheme for error messages etc:
31
32 as_fatal() is used when gas is quite confused and
33 continuing the assembly is pointless. In this case we
34 exit immediately with error status.
35
36 as_bad() is used to mark errors that result in what we
37 presume to be a useless object file. Say, we ignored
38 something that might have been vital. If we see any of
39 these, assembly will continue to the end of the source,
40 no object file will be produced, and we will terminate
41 with error status. The new option, -Z, tells us to
42 produce an object file anyway but we still exit with
43 error status. The assumption here is that you don't want
44 this object file but we could be wrong.
45
46 as_warn() is used when we have an error from which we
47 have a plausible error recovery. eg, masking the top
48 bits of a constant that is longer than will fit in the
49 destination. In this case we will continue to assemble
50 the source, although we may have made a bad assumption,
51 and we will produce an object file and return normal exit
52 status (ie, no error). The new option -X tells us to
53 treat all as_warn() errors as as_bad() errors. That is,
54 no object file will be produced and we will exit with
55 error status. The idea here is that we don't kill an
56 entire make because of an error that we knew how to
57 correct. On the other hand, sometimes you might want to
58 stop the make at these points.
59
60 as_tsktsk() is used when we see a minor error for which
61 our error recovery action is almost certainly correct.
62 In this case, we print a message and then assembly
63 continues as though no error occurred. */
64
65 static void
66 identify (char *file)
67 {
68 static int identified;
69
70 if (identified)
71 return;
72 identified++;
73
74 if (!file)
75 {
76 unsigned int x;
77 as_where (&file, &x);
78 }
79
80 if (file)
81 fprintf (stderr, "%s: ", file);
82 fprintf (stderr, _("Assembler messages:\n"));
83 }
84
85 /* The number of warnings issued. */
86 static int warning_count;
87
88 int
89 had_warnings (void)
90 {
91 return warning_count;
92 }
93
94 /* Nonzero if we've hit a 'bad error', and should not write an obj file,
95 and exit with a nonzero error code. */
96
97 static int error_count;
98
99 int
100 had_errors (void)
101 {
102 return error_count;
103 }
104
105 /* Print the current location to stderr. */
106
107 static void
108 as_show_where (void)
109 {
110 char *file;
111 unsigned int line;
112
113 as_where (&file, &line);
114 identify (file);
115 if (file)
116 fprintf (stderr, "%s:%u: ", file, line);
117 }
118
119 /* Like perror(3), but with more info. */
120
121 void
122 as_perror (const char *gripe, /* Unpunctuated error theme. */
123 const char *filename)
124 {
125 const char *errtxt;
126 int saved_errno = errno;
127
128 as_show_where ();
129 fprintf (stderr, gripe, filename);
130 errno = saved_errno;
131 errtxt = bfd_errmsg (bfd_get_error ());
132 fprintf (stderr, ": %s\n", errtxt);
133 errno = 0;
134 bfd_set_error (bfd_error_no_error);
135 }
136

366
367 /* Send to stderr a string as a fatal message, and print location of
368 error in input file(s).
369 Please only use this for when we DON'T have some recovery action.
370 It xexit()s with a warning status. */
371
372 #ifdef USE_STDARG
373 void
374 as_fatal (const char *format, ...)
375 {
376 va_list args;
377
378 as_show_where ();
379 va_start (args, format);
380 fprintf (stderr, _("Fatal error: "));
381 vfprintf (stderr, format, args);
382 (void) putc ('\n', stderr);
383 va_end (args);
384 /* Delete the output file, if it exists. This will prevent make from
385 thinking that a file was created and hence does not need rebuilding. */
386 if (out_file_name != NULL)
387 unlink_if_ordinary (out_file_name);
388 xexit (EXIT_FAILURE);
389 }
390 #else
391 void
392 as_fatal (format, va_alist)
393 char *format;
394 va_dcl
395 {
396 va_list args;
397
398 as_show_where ();
399 va_start (args);
400 fprintf (stderr, _("Fatal error: "));
401 vfprintf (stderr, format, args);
402 (void) putc ('\n', stderr);
403 va_end (args);
404 xexit (EXIT_FAILURE);
405 }
406 #endif /* not NO_STDARG */
407
408 /* Indicate assertion failure.
409 Arguments: Filename, line number, optional function name. */
410
411 void
412 as_assert (const char *file, int line, const char *fn)
413 {
414 as_show_where ();
415 fprintf (stderr, _("Internal error!\n"));
416 if (fn)
417 fprintf (stderr, _("Assertion failure in %s at %s line %d.\n"),
418 fn, file, line);
419 else
420 fprintf (stderr, _("Assertion failure at %s line %d.\n"), file, line);
421 fprintf (stderr, _("Please report this bug.\n"));
422 xexit (EXIT_FAILURE);
423 }
424
425 /* as_abort: Print a friendly message saying how totally hosed we are,
426 and exit without producing a core file. */
427
428 void
429 as_abort (const char *file, int line, const char *fn)
430 {
431 as_show_where ();
432 if (fn)
433 fprintf (stderr, _("Internal error, aborting at %s line %d in %s\n"),
434 file, line, fn);
435 else
436 fprintf (stderr, _("Internal error, aborting at %s line %d\n"),
437 file, line);
438 fprintf (stderr, _("Please report this bug.\n"));
439 xexit (EXIT_FAILURE);
440 }
